    What is Wool Ball?
    Wool Ball offers a wide range of open-source AI models for various tasks including text generation, image classification, speech-to-text, and more. By leveraging a distributed network of browsers, Wool Ball efficiently processes AI tasks at significantly lower costs. The platform also enables users to earn rewards by sharing their browser's idle resources, ensuring secure and efficient use through WebAssembly technology.

    What is MLC Web LLM Assistant?
    Web LLM Assistant is a lightweight open-source framework that transforms your browser into an AI inference platform. It leverages WebGPU and WebAssembly backends to run LLMs directly on client devices without servers, ensuring privacy and offline capability. Users can import and switch between models such as LLaMA, Vicuna, and Alpaca, chat with the assistant, and see streaming responses. The modular React-based UI supports themes, conversation history, system prompts, and plugin-like extensions for custom behaviors. Developers can customize the interface, integrate external APIs, and fine-tune prompts. Deployment only requires hosting static files; no backend servers are needed. Web LLM Assistant democratizes AI by enabling high-performance local inference in any modern web browser.

    What is DataGPTd?
    DataGPTD is a robust browser-based data analysis tool designed to empower users by simplifying data handling and analytics. It allows you to visualize, collaborate, and compute your data without the need for server uploads, ensuring security and efficiency. By converting text to executable code through WebAssembly in a sandbox and leveraging language models, DataGPTD streamlines complex data tasks and provides insights, making it a versatile tool for data-driven decision-making.
